Overview

The G5V-1-T90 DC5 is an ultra-miniature SPDT low-signal relay designed for high-density PCB mounting. It features a fully-sealed construction and is optimized for telecommunication and signal switching applications with a 5VDC coil voltage. This relay is specifically designed to meet FCC Part 68 standards for telecommunications equipment.

Why Choose This Part

The relay offers an ultra-miniature footprint of 12.5mm by 7.5mm, saving significant PCB area in dense designs. Its fully-sealed construction allows for automatic soldering and cleaning processes while ensuring reliability in harsh environments. With high sensitivity and a fast 5ms operate time, it is highly responsive for critical signal switching.

Key Specifications

Coil Type Non Latching
Relay Type General Purpose
Seal Rating Sealed - Fully
Coil Current 30 mA
Coil Voltage 5VDC
Contact Form SPDT (1 Form C)
Operate Time 5 ms
Release Time 5 ms
Mounting Type Through Hole
Approval Agency CSA, UR
Contact Material Silver (Ag), Gold (Au)
Switching Voltage 125VAC, 60VDC - Max
Termination Style PC Pin
Load - Max Switching 125VA, 60W
Must Operate Voltage 3.5 VDC
Must Release Voltage 0.5 VDC
Operating Temperature -40degC ~ 90degC
Contact Rating (Current) 1 A

Getting Started

When integrating this relay, ensure a flyback diode is placed across the coil to protect driving circuitry from inductive spikes. The PCB layout should account for the through-hole pinout and provide sufficient clearance between the low-voltage coil and the switched signal contacts. For evaluation, the relay can be prototyped on a standard 0.1 inch pitch perforated board with slight modifications to accommodate the offset terminal pins.
